At the beginning there were too fast atoms, then extremely accurate atomic clocks and now there is navigation at your phone. These are some of the steps that science had to take to make it easier for us to get where we need and all of them involved physics - professor William Daniel Philllips received Nobel Prize in Physics for his discovery how to slow down atoms with laser. How can you push an atom with light to make it go slower? Why does he believe that universe is a magnificent and beautiful kind of a gift to us?
